Equipment of the LCAM-FNWI can only be booked by trained users. The booking scheme is displayed in webcalenders, each specific for one instrument. This reservation system allows us to stay in touch with all our users and to notify you in case of problems or new installations. Please do not forget to contact us when you want to cancel a reservation.

How to sign-up a microscope:
Go to the webcalender of your preferred microscope to validate if there is time available for your experiment. For reservation of the microscope send an email to cam.microscopy@gmail.com. As soon as possible the microscope will be booked and you will receive a confirmation email. First time users should contact Erik Manders (+6225) to discuss the new project, select the most appropriate microscope and to arrange a training session, since only trained users are allowed to work with the microscopes.
